Firstly i have to say that my diet might not work for everyone but i respond best to it.
I eat mainly chicken,pork,beef,whole wheat bread and pasta, oats, greek yoghurt,bananas, apples, oranges, chia seeds, brocolli,spinach, carrots, sweet and normal potatoes,red lenthils , olive oil, iodine salt, popcorn, cheese, tomato sauce and paste, eggs ,different berries, brazil nuts, tahini, coffee and once a week i get a pizza.

What do you consider to be fast starches?
I imagine no bread, pasta, rice, potatoes. What else?
 
What do you consider to be fast starches?
I imagine no bread, pasta, rice, potatoes. What else?
Bananas contain up to 35% starch. I don't eat them at all except rarely as preworkout fuel. It's a garbage food to eat on off-days.

Oatmeal/oats are unfortunately full of starch and are therefore a horrible offday or cutting food.
Which is sad because I love oats on workout days as a source of healthy carbs/workout fuel.

Yes, ultimately everything boils down to CICO (calories in, calories out), but body composition wise it's just not a good idea to stuff sugar and starches down your throat when you are not going to be active on that day.
